CREAMY SWEET POTATO AND ROSEMARY SOUP
Provided by Giada De Laurentiis
Time 42m
Yield 4 to 6 servings (8 cups)
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- In an 8-quart stockpot, melt the butter and oil together over medium-high heat. Add the shallots and garlic. Season with salt and pepper and cook until soft, about 3 to 4 minutes. Add the sweet potatoes, rosemary and chicken broth. Season with salt and pepper, to taste. Bring the mixture to a boil, reduce the heat and simmer until the sweet potatoes are very tender, about 20 to 25 minutes. Turn off the heat and remove the rosemary stems. Using an immersion blender, blend the mixture until smooth and thick. Whisk in the mascarpone cheese and maple syrup until smooth. Season with salt and pepper, to taste. Keep the soup warm over low heat until ready to serve.
- Cook's Note: The soup can also be pureed by ladling, in batches, into a food processor or blender and blended until smooth.

SWEET POTATO-GARLIC SOUP WITH CHILE OIL
This silky-smooth sweet potato soup features the deep flavor of roasted garlic and a splendid dose of garlicky, Sichuan peppercorn chile oil, which delivers heat and a tingling sensation with every spoonful. Roasting the sweet potatoes at a high temperature does a few things in this recipe: First, it develops the sweet potato's flavors, and second, it softens the tubers, yielding a smooth texture. Serve this soup with thick slices of buttered, toasted bread to sop it up.
Provided by Nik Sharma
Categories dinner, lunch, weekday, soups and stews, main course
Time 40m
Yield 3 to 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Heat oven to 400 degrees. Remove some of the excess paper from the head of garlic, leaving the bulb intact. Rub the bulb with 2 teaspoons oil and place it in the center of a rimmed baking sheet.
- In a large bowl, toss the sweet potatoes, onion and cumin seeds with the remaining 2 tablespoons olive oil. Spread them in a single layer on the baking sheet and roast until the sweet potatoes are slightly caramelized and tender and the garlic has softened, about 25 minutes. Remove from the oven and let rest until the vegetables are cool enough to handle, about 8 minutes.
- While the vegetables roast, prepare the chile oil: In a small saucepan over medium, heat the neutral oil, taking care not to burn it. (Measure the oil's temperature with a thermometer; it should read about 325 degrees. You could also test the temperature with a Sichuan peppercorn: It should sizzle when tossed in.)
- Once the oil is hot, remove it from the heat, add the red-pepper flakes, garlic and Sichuan peppercorns. Cover with a lid and let steep for at least 20 minutes. (The oil can be prepared a day ahead of time and st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 1 week.)
- Transfer the cooked sweet potato mixture to a blender. Squeeze the softened garlic pulp out of the cloves and add the pulp to the blender. Add 1/4 cup stock to the baking sheet and scrape off any bits that have stuck to the pan. Add the stock and bits to the blender. Add the remaining stock, the black pepper and turmeric to the blender and purée on high speed until smooth and creamy. Taste and add salt as needed. Transfer the soup to a medium saucepan and rewarm over low as needed.
- Divide the soup among bowls. Give the chile oil a stir and drizzle the soup with a generous tablespoon or two. Serve immediately.
SWEET POTATO SOUP WITH FRIED PANCETTA AND ROSEMARY CROUTONS
Categories Soup/Stew Blender Food Processor Potato Quick & Easy Lunch Rosemary Bacon Sweet Potato/Yam Fall Simmer Bon Appétit Peanut Free Tree Nut Free Soy Free
Yield Makes 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Sauté pancetta in heavy large saucepan over medium-high heat until crisp, about 5 minutes. Using slotted spoon, transfer pancetta to paper towels.
- Add 1 1/2 tablespoons butter to drippings in same saucepan; add shallots and reduce heat to medium. sauté until shallots are soft and golden, about 4 minutes. Stir in 1 teaspoon rosemary, then mashed sweet potatoes and 31/2 cups broth. Bring to boil. Reduce heat to medium-low and simmer 10 minutes to blend flavors, adding more broth by 1/4 cupfuls to thin soup, if desired.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Puree soup in blender or processor if necessary.
- Meanwhile, melt remaining 11/2 tablespoons butter in small skillet over medium-high heat. Add bread cubes and remaining 1/2 teaspoon rosemary and sauté until croutons are crisp and golden, about 3 minutes.
- Ladle soup into bowls. Top with croutons and pancetta and serve.

CREAMY POTATO WITH ROSEMARY SOUP
A pureed vegetable soup can be an impressive, easy and affordable first course for an elegant dinner, or even a light dinner on its own with salad and bread.
Provided by USA WEEKEND columnist Pam Anderson
Categories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es Soup Recipes Cream Soup Recipes Cream of Potato Soup Recipes
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Heat oil over medium-high heat in a large, deep saute pan until shimmering.
- Add potatoes, then onion; saute, stirring very little at first, then more frequently, until squash start to turn golden brown, 7 to 8 minutes.
- Reduce heat to low and add butter, sugar and garlic; continue cooking until all vegetables are a rich spotty caramel color, about 10 minutes longer.
- Add cayenne pepper; continue to saute until fragrant, 30 seconds to 1 minute longer.
- Add broth; bring to a simmer over medium-high heat. Reduce heat to low and simmer, partially covered, until potatoes are tender, about 10 minutes.
- Using an immersion blender or traditional blender, puree (adding fresh rosemary)until very smooth, 30 seconds to 1 minute. (If using a traditional blender, vent it either by removing the lid's pop-out center or by lifting one edge of the lid. Drape the blender canister with a kitchen towel. To 'clean' the canister, pour in a little half-and-half, blend briefly, then add to the soup.)
- Return to pan (or a soup pot); add enough half-and-half so the mixture is souplike, yet thick enough to float garnish. Taste, and add salt and pepper if needed. Heat through, ladle into bowls, garnish and serve.
